Account recovery, Mirefall build system. Context: dependency pinning is strict — lockfiles only, no floating ranges, pins reviewed quarterly. If your contractor account is locked after a failed pin-override attempt, do not open a new account. Run the recovery flow from the Tallow console. When prompted, enter the recovery passphrase below.

unlock words, yawig-kagef: gordor-holvan-ulaael-pramir-ulaiel-tamdor

### Record deduplication — plugin signing

Plugins extending the Mergewell deduplication pipeline must be signed before the matcher service will load them. After your plugin passes the canonical-record test suite, package it, then sign the archive. Unsigned or mismatched plugins are quarantined automatically. For sandbox testing, sign against the shared development key below.

deploy key for kajof-fajop: bky6_gDHw9Q

# Artifact Signing — Quillpress Incremental Rebuilds

For the sync: every incremental rebuild of the Quillpress static site now produces a signed artifact. Only changed pages go into the delta bundle; the signer covers the bundle plus the page index. CI rejects unsigned deltas. Rotation happens quarterly; old signatures stay valid for verification only. If you deploy manually, sign with the key currently in rotation, which is the following.

rollout seal: bky4_x7Gc

## Service Accounts — StormFan Alert Fan-Out

The fan-out worker authenticates to the internal dispatch tier using the svc-stormfan account. Rotate quarterly; scopes are limited to publish-only on alert topics. If deliveries stall during your shift, verify the worker is using the current credential, reproduced below for reference.

API key for kaweg-hahif: kto4_rAjZ